Exploring the absurdity and tragic isolation of human lives, the greatest of the Nobel Prize-winner's dramas, first performed in 1921, involves six family members who arrive at a theater and demand that it put on their life story. Reissue.

Blurring the border between fiction and life, between the stage and the world outside, Six Characters in search of an Author exploded onto the stage in 1921 as one of the unique achievements of twentieth-century drama.
